UMIDIGI’s F1 Play offers a 48MP Camera for Everyone

Remember, you heard it here first. UMIDIGI has introduced a F1 Play to battle out the Redmi Note 7 on shopping stores. It’s no surprise the first F1 smartphone offers a bigger storage space and a more expensive price tag.

However, UMIDIGI has taken the bull by its horn and introduced a cheaper variant that will at least have the same price tag with the Redmi’s trending flagship. The F1 Play has similar configurations with the first variant, it’s built around a 6.3-inch FHD+ display with 1080 x 2340 pixels in resolution.

It runs on Android 9 Pie out of the box and powered by the same Helio P60 chipset. In the storage department, the company reduced the space to 64GB, while maintaining the 6GB RAM.

It comes with the trendy 48MP rear camera alongside an 8MP depth sensor and a 16MP selfie. The battery is still 5150mAh, there’s USB type C, NFC, 3.5 mm jack and Face Unlock. Price now starts at $219.
